Abstract
The alpha-decay constant to fission cross section ratio for epi-cadmium neutron induced fission of 237Np, 241Am have been measured using solid state nuclear track detectors (SSNTDs). The measured values were (0.63±0.14).109 s-1.cm-2, (2.31±0.46).1012 s-1.cm-2 for 237Np and 241Am, respectively. The alpha to spontaneous fission branching ratio for 243Am was also measured to be (2.66±0.50).1010 using SSNTDs. These ratios are useful as signatures for the trace level identification of these actinides.
